Output 3d5088e22a0ee2ad99fc8b40d7061c708c3924fca5bef4fa15594b6e2be9c3ea:0

value
39563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2a2aae306efc64e4a1a24e520d8656220f9123c OP_EQUAL
address
3LtkhAaoZPXELMWYnCm8nFkyyXwQJcywc5
transaction
3d5088e22a0ee2ad99fc8b40d7061c708c3924fca5bef4fa15594b6e2be9c3ea
spent
true